Abstract
Urban areas allocate a large part of their space to roadways, often underutilised outside peak hours, revealing the inefficiency of fixed road space allocation. This study assesses the suitability of Design Thinking in creating dynamic and equitable solutions for urban space management, based on an empirical study with master’s students from Instituto Superior Técnico. Participants were challenged to propose solutions for the dynamic redistribution of streets in complex areas of Lisbon, where movement and stationary uses coexist. They followed the Design Thinking stages defined by the d.school: Empathy, Definition, Ideation, Prototyping, and Testing. The proposals were grouped into three categories: (i) Social and Leisure Spaces, focused on urban social interaction; (ii) Innovations in Mobility and Transport, aimed at optimising road space management and public transport; and (iii) Safety and Accessibility, seeking to improve urban navigation for vulnerable populations. Solutions were also classified by technological level, using a scale from 0 (non-technological) to 5 (fully connected). The most advanced level achieved was Level 3 (Infrastructure and Vehicle Technology), while Level 2 recorded the highest number of proposals, with three solutions. Possibilities for advancing to higher levels were also explored. The study concludes that Design Thinking is suitable for developing dynamic and fair urban space solutions, although it presents methodological limitations, particularly in anticipating more advanced technological levels (Levels 4 and 5). It also reinforces the importance of participatory (bottom-up) approaches and highlights the need for flexible and innovative strategies that address community-specific needs through the Design Thinking process.
